Haparanda vs Mogoca Climate & Distance Between

Russia flag
  • The distance between Haparanda, Sweden and Mogoca, Russia is approximately 4,959 km or 3,082 mi.
  • To reach Haparanda in this distance one would set out from Mogoca bearing 324.5°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Haparanda bearing 236.9° or WSW .
  • Haparanda has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Mogoca has a boreal subarctic climate with dry winters (Dwc).
  • Both are in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
  • The annual average temperature is 6.2 °C (11.2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.9 °C (32.2°F) less in Haparanda.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 125 mm (4.9 in) more which is equivalent to 125 l/m² (3.07 US gal/ft²) or 1,250,000 l/ha (133,633 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12° lower in Haparanda than in Mogoca.
